| Ilokano Word: | English Word: | Part of Speech: |
| abel | cloth | noun |
| Definition: a fabric formed by weaving, felting, etc., from wool, hair, silk, flax, cotton, or other fiber, used for garments, upholstery, and many other items. | ||
| Ilokano Synonyms: agabel, mangabel, ablen | ||
| Ilokano Antonyms: N/A | ||
| English Synonyms: weave | ||
